开发技术科普贴。Android-自定义viewAndroid开发干货

Android伸手党系列之六:Android开发进阶

2016-09-01  本文已影响9573人  Dear_HS

这是android伸手党知识收集系列的第六篇,来整理android开发进阶相关知识:Window,View,事件分发,NFC,蓝牙等。

Android View 简介


Android View事件体系

郭神的两篇:
鸿神的两篇:

Android View 事件分发机制 源码解析 (上)
Android ViewGroup事件分发机制

其它

其它事件


Android Scroller

讲解得很详细

Android ViewDragHelper


Android TouchHelper


Android 自定义View

自定义View 基础篇
孙群自定义View系列
  1. 量算、布局及绘图机制概述
    Android中View的量算、布局及绘图机制
  2. 量算
    源码解析Android中View的measure量算过程
  3. 布局
    源码解析Android中View的layout布局过程
  4. 绘图
    Android中Canvas绘图基础详解(附源码下载)
    Android中Canvas绘图之PorterDuffXfermode使用及工作原理详解
    Android中Canvas绘图之Shader使用图文详解
    Android中Canvas绘图之MaskFilter图文详解(附源码下载)
    Android中GPU硬件加速控制及其在2D图形绘制上的局限
    图文详解Andorid中用Shape定义GradientDrawable
  5. 触摸事件
    Android中的MotionEvent
    Android中TouchEvent触摸事件机制
  6. 定义XML属性
    Android中View自定义XML属性详解以及R.attr与R.styleable的区别
爱哥的自定义控件系统
郭神的三篇

Android视图绘制流程完全解析,带你一步步深入了解View(二)
Android视图状态及重绘流程分析,带你一步步深入了解View(三)
Android自定义View的实现方法,带你一步步深入了解View(四)

GcsSloop的魔法世界
自定义View系列文章二
自定义View系列文章三
自定义View系列四

View篇

ViewGroup篇

自定义View小例子
Android Window and WindowManager

Android 动画

Tween动画和补间动画

属性动画

郭神三篇

动画总结

进程保活


热修复


性能优化

启动时间优化
内存优化

来自郭神的四篇

来自腾讯 胡凯(AndroidTraining中文版的作者) 10几篇内存优化系列
来自 工匠若水
其它

React Native开发

江清清的技术专栏 ---专注移动技术开发(Android/IOS)、React Native源码分析、React Native教程、React Native博客


屏幕适配


Android 启动相关


Android缓存


Handler


NFC


传感器


蓝牙


Android 硬件加速


扫描


支付相关


Android数据传输


Android App 轮询


Android App 升级与更新


Android 异常处理


进程间通信


其它

上一篇 下一篇

猜你喜欢

热点阅读